135.设有语句int a =3;,则执行了语句a+=a—=a*a;后,变量a的值是 ( ) A. 3 B. 0 C. 9 D.-12请帮我选出正确答案~~谢谢~

来源:学生作业帮助网 编辑:六六作业网 时间:2024/11/16 03:47:58
135.设有语句inta=3;,则执行了语句a+=a—=a*a;后,变量a的值是()A.3B.0C.9D.-12请帮我选出正确答案~~谢谢~135.设有语句inta=3;,则执行了语句a+=a—=a*

135.设有语句int a =3;,则执行了语句a+=a—=a*a;后,变量a的值是 ( ) A. 3 B. 0 C. 9 D.-12请帮我选出正确答案~~谢谢~
135.设有语句int a =3;,则执行了语句a+=a—=a*a;后,变量a的值是 ( ) A. 3 B. 0 C. 9 D.-12
请帮我选出正确答案~~谢谢~

135.设有语句int a =3;,则执行了语句a+=a—=a*a;后,变量a的值是 ( ) A. 3 B. 0 C. 9 D.-12请帮我选出正确答案~~谢谢~
-12.
首先等号的运算顺序是从右至左.
1 .计算 表达式a*a =9;
2 .计算a-=9 也是一个表达式 ,其类似于 ===》a = a -9 = 3 - 9 = -6;
3 .计算a += -6 ; a = a + -6 .在第2步时,a已经被重赋值 -6 ,所以这时 a = -6 + -6 =-12

设有定义语句“int a[][3]={{0},{1},{2}};则a[1][2]的值为多少? 设有语句int a=3; 则执行了语句a+=a+a;后,变量a的值是( ) C语言中,设有“int c=3;int a;a=2+(c+=c++,c+15,++c);”,执行语句后a=? 设有定义int a=3,b,c=5;将以下3条语句++a;b=a+c;++c;写成一条语句 设有以下语句:int a=1,b=2,c; c=a^(b 设有定义int a ,b=10;则执行语句a=b 设有定义:int a[2][2]={1,2,3,4},(*p)[2];,则在语句p=a;p++;后,**p的值为(3) 设有以下定义的语句;int a [3][2]={10,20,30,40,50,60}.(*p)【2】;p=a; 则*(*(p+2)+1的值为? 设有定义语句“int a[][3]={{0},{1},{2}};则a[1][2]的值为多少?能有详细解题步骤吗 设有定义语句“int a=10,*p=&a;”,则表达式“a+*p”的值是: 设有语句 int a=3;,则执行了语句 a+=a-=a*=a;后,变量 a 的值是( B ).A.3 B.0 C.9 D.-12请问是如何计算的, 计算机C语言,为什么?11.设有语句int a=3; 则执行了语句a+=a-=a*a;后,变量a的值是______.A.3 B.0 C.9 D.-12 设有语句int a=3;则执行了语句a+=a-=a*a;后,变量a的值是(  ) A) 3 B) 0 C) 9 D) -12 12、 设有语句int a=3; 则执行了语句a-=a+=a*a;后,变量a的值是( ).A)3 B)0 C)-12 D)24 设有语句int a=3,则执行了语句a+=a-=a*a;后,变量a的值是( )A.3 B.0 C.9 D.-12 设有语句int a=5;则执行语句a+=a-=a*a后,变量A的值是 设有语句“int x=3,y=1;”,则表达式(!x ||-- y)的值是 135.设有语句int a =3;,则执行了语句a+=a—=a*a;后,变量a的值是 ( ) A. 3 B. 0 C. 9 D.-12请帮我选出正确答案~~谢谢~